The average colorist textile gross salary in Hungary is 5 020 335 Ft or an equivalent hourly rate of 2 414 Ft. In addition, they earn an average bonus of 75 305 Ft.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Hungary. An entry level colorist textile (1-3 years of experience) earns an average salary of 3 799 893 Ft. On the other end, a senior level colorist textile (8+ years of experience) earns an average salary of 6 045 052 Ft.

Hungary is a landlocked country in Central Europe. Spanning 93,030 square kilometres (35,920 sq mi) of the Carpathian Basin, it is bordered by Slovakia to the north, Ukraine to the northeast, Romania to the east and southeast, Serbia to the south, Croatia and Slovenia to the southwest, and Austria to the west. Hungary has a population of 9.6 million, mostly ethnic Hungarians and a significant Romani minority. Hungarian is the official language, and Budapest is the country's capital and largest city...

Picks color combinations to be used in design creations. Creates designs, sketches, and color names for apparel and accessories. Understands the properties and function of textiles and color theory. Assesses lab and production dyeing results, pulls rejects, and ensures consistent color quality of garments. Organizes and keeps records of approved submits, color library, and lab dips.
